Zucchini bread is one of our favorites in the summertime when zucchini is abundant. This old-fashioned, simple zucchini bread recipe has the perfect balance of sweetness and spice. It's tender and forms a lovely sugary crust on top. Add your favorite nut - we opted for walnuts. They add a nutty flavor and a bit of crunch. prep time 20 Min
cook time 1 Hr
method Bake
yield

Ingredients

  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
  • 3 - eggs, beaten
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1 cup canola oil
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la
  • 2 cups zucchini, grated
  • 1 cup nuts, ch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g

How To Make zucchini bread

  • Two greased loaf pans.
    Step 1
    Preheat oven to 325. Grease and flour 2 loaf pans.
  • Flour and spices sifted in a bowl.
    Step 2
    Sift flour. Mix flour, nutmeg, cinnamon, salt, baking soda, and baking powder. Set aside.
  • Eggs, sugar, and vanilla whisked in a silver bowl.
    Step 3
    In a large bowl, beat eggs, sugars, canola oil, and vanilla.
  • Slowly adding sifted flour to egg mixture.
    Step 4
    Stir sifted ingredients into egg mixture.
  • Mixing zucchini and nuts into batter.
    Step 5
    Blend in zucchini and nuts.
  • Batter poured into two loaf pans.
    Step 6
    Pour into loaf pans.
  • Two loaves of zucchini bread baking in the oven.
    Step 7
    Bake at 325 for 60-70 minutes or until toothpick in center comes out clean.
